Effective Field Theory of pure Gravity and the Renormalization Group

Abstract

The general structure of the renormalization group equations for the low energy effective field theory formulation of pure gravity is presented. The solution of these equations takes a particular simple form if the mass scale of the effective theory is much smaller than the Planck mass (a possibility compatible with the renormalization of the effective theory). A theory with just one free renormalized parameter is obtained when contributions suppressed by inverse powers of the Planck mass are neglected.
